Wyoming Tops 2026 Best States to Retire Rankings

😊 Feel Good

A new study reveals the best and worst states for Americans entering retirement, with affordability and healthcare access shaping where 61 million seniors can spend their golden years. Wyoming claims the top spot while high-cost states struggle to meet retirees' needs.

America's retirement landscape is getting a major makeover as more people reach their golden years and face tough choices about where to live.

The population of Americans age 65 and older hit 61.2 million in 2024, according to U.S. Census Bureau data. With retirees now living nearly two decades longer than previous generations, decisions about location matter more than ever.

Senior care company CareScout analyzed affordability, quality of life, and healthcare access across all 50 states to help future retirees make informed choices. The results reveal clear winners and losers in the race to attract older Americans.

Wyoming earned the top ranking thanks to zero personal income tax and strong health outcomes for seniors. The wide-open spaces and tax-free living offer financial breathing room when every dollar counts.

New Hampshire, Vermont, Montana, and South Dakota rounded out the top five. New Hampshire stood out with no personal income tax and one of the highest average Social Security incomes in the nation, giving retirees more money to enjoy their hard-earned free time.

The bottom of the list tells a different story. New Jersey ranked as the worst state for retirement despite offering the highest average Social Security income in America. High living costs and steep income tax rates eat away at retirement savings faster than anywhere else.

Massachusetts and New York faced similar challenges with crushing tax burdens and expensive daily living. Alabama and Mississippi struggled for different reasons, with poor health outcomes among older adults and fewer recreational and cultural opportunities.
